You make a lot of good points.  However, I question Proposal #10.  The local 
affiliate determines what Divisions, Sections and Classes to include in its 
show schedule.  AIS does not require sections for types of irises not grown 
in the local area.  Some shows are for only one type of iris.  As a frequent 
producer of iris show schedules, I include sections for all classes of 
bearded irises, usually Siberians and lump all other beardless in one 
section.  But there is always a provision in the schedule for adding or 
dividing sections, if needed.
